Governments & Winter Preparation
Because a lot of renewables are intermittent, it is incredibly important for governments to think about Winter preparation.
An example of how to do this is to have “on-demand” non-renewable energy sources (as well as “on-demand” renewable energy sources) still working, even if it means through government subsidies. People are the most important thing.
The 2050 final energy solution will either be
something similar to the current renewables plus 100th generation battery technology, or
a mixture of the current technology plus “on-demand” renewable energy sources, like hydropower, green hydrogen and geothermal energy. Until we have enough “on-demand” renewables to make up for any shortage of sun or wind, we will be relying on “on-demand” energy sources like coal, oil and gas to make up for this.
